Hello: This series was applied to netdev/net-next.git (main) by Jakub Kicinski [off-list ref]: On Tue, 18 Nov 2025 14:58:51 +0100 you wrote:
This patchset refactors and slightly improves the reset handling of `mdio_device`. The patches were split from a larger series, discussed previously in the links below. The difference between v2 and v3, is that the helper function declarations have been moved to a new header file: drivers/net/phy/mdio-private.h See links for the previous versions, and for the now separate leak fix.
